Web1 dag geleden · Based on Bayes' theorem, the naive Bayes algorithm is a probabilistic classification technique. It is predicated on the idea that a feature's presence in a class is unrelated to the presence of other features. Web3 feb. 2024 · The Bayes' formula is: P (A B) = P (B A) x P (A) / P (B) Where: P (A B): This variable stands for the probability that A occurs if B occurs. P (B A): This is the probability that B may occur if A occurs. P (A): This variable stands for the probability of event A. P (B): This variable stands for the probability of event B.
